Reports

Reports provide an overview of sales according to selected criteria (daily totals, periodical (e.g., monthly),
etc.). There are two basic types of reports: „X" and „Z".
„X" reports print out specific sales values (according to the report selected) without zeroing out this data in
the cash register memory
„Z" reports print out the sales values of the selected report, and after the printing of these values, zeroes
out the cash register memory.

Bar codes

A bar code is a graphic encoding of a number signifying a product according to strictly defined internatio-
nal regulations. If a product has a bar code assigned, the bar code is depicted on each packaging for this
product. The most frequently used codes for products in Europe are the 13-digit code according to the EAN
norm (EAN - 13) and the 8-digit code (EAN-8). The Euro-50iTE Mini cash register is also capable of working
with EAN bar codes which contain an expanded 2 or 5-digit section.
